U-Boat 1942 Limited EditionThis year the world known brand U-Boat presented its new models 2009. These are U-Boat 1942 Limited Edition and Classico 1001 Limited edition.
The conception of U-Boat is “unusual watch in unusual case”. U-Boat watches feature big cases (about 53 mm), highly readable dial and button that is placed on the left.

U-Boat 1942 Limited Edition model is one of the world’s biggest watches. The watch is released in limited edition of 29 pieces. These are mechanical watches with manual winding, diameter 36,6 mm, 17 ruby jewels. Frequency – 18000, power reserve – 46 hours. The watch is water resistant to 100 meters.

The model U-Boat Classico 1001 Limited edition is released in limited series of 1001 pieces. These are mechanical watches that are constructed by U-Boat technology. The watch features 25 ruby jewels as well as power reserve of 40 hours.

The watch displays hours, minutes, seconds and date that is on 4 o’clock position. Frequency – 28800. The case is made out of titanium. Button on the left side of the case. Diameter -55 mm. Weight – about 205 gr. The case back features engraving with serial number and 1001 logo. The watch features double dial – luminescent elements in yellow, orange or blue color are put on the base that features a black pattern. Arabic numerals, luminescent hands with 1001 logo. The watch is water resistant to 1001 meters. The watch features an extra-thick sapphire crystal. Comes with black rubber strap and double buckle. Both these great models will be available in the coming months.

Omega Seamaster 007 SpecialOmega Seamaster Professional lineup is fantastically popular not only due to high quality watches. As well this lineup got great fame due to the fact that in the last four movies in the James Bond saga Omega Seamaster Professionals were worn by Pierce Brosnan and Daniel Craig. Thousands of people from all over the world come to watch shops with only one question – “Do you have the watch like James Bond wears”?
Everyone understands that the world known brand Omega is gladly milking its status as “the choice of James Bond”. Baselworld 2008 was not an exception. Omega presented its new Seamaster 007 Limited Edition.

The new Seamaster 007 Professional is a bit different from those worn in the movies. Those had blue dials and bezels, while this one features a black dial and bezel. The reason for such a change is evident – the brand had already issued 2 007 limited edition Seamasters that featured blue bezels and dials.

Beginning with 1995 Omega has been associated with James Bond saga. In that year Pierce Brosnan became the new James Bond and wore Omega Seamaster Quartz professional in “Golden Eye”. Omega 007 BaselIn 2002, when Die Another Day came out, Omega released a special 007 edition of the lineup Omega Speedmaster Professional. In this film Pierce Brosnan wore the well known Omega Seamaster Professional, of course, with additional features, special for secret agent.
In 2006 in conjunction of the new Casino Royal the brand released a limited 007 edition of the Omega Speedmaster Professional with 007 logo on the second hand. Casino Royal was the 21th film in James Bond saga. In this film the new James Bond appeared – Daniel Craig, the new malefactor and new “James Bond’s” girlfriend. The only thing that remained the same was the watch brand that is preferred by mister Bond – this again was Omega. That time James Bond wore Omega Seamaster 300 M Diver Chronometer.
The 2008 version came again with 007 logo, this time in red.
Each of the limited edition wristwatches has been produced in 10.007 pieces.

It is not by chance that Omega became James Bond’s choice. This brand has a very long history that is full of victories and achievements. Watches by Omega have proved their fantastic accuracy and reliability in 1965 in NASA tests in no gravity conditions and in extreme temperatures – from -18 up to 93 C. Only Omega Speedmaster watches passed the test and were chosen for Apollon program. In 1969 Omega Speedmaster got on the Moon on the wrist of Buzz Oldrin.
Omega watches are known ones of the most water resistant watches. On November, 23 1976 Jacques Mayol who was the first free diver to descend to 100 meters wore Omega Seamaster while diving.
Together with these achievements Omega has frequently been the official timekeeper for the Olympic Games, beginning with 1932.

Breitling adtThe famous Breitling Navitimer Quartz Chronograph appeared in the late 1940s, when the watchmaking company integrated an aviation circular slide rule in their chronographs. This built-in computer allowed pilots to perform a wide range of flight calculations. It was capable of dividing and multiplying numbers, converting miles into kilometers and even calculating descent rate. The wristwatch was officially introduced in 1952. It immediately became very popular with pilots and was even named the official watch of the AOPA (Aircraft Owners and Pilot Association). Even today the Breitling Navitimer Quartz Chronograph is the most famous timepiece that Breitling has ever produced.

Naturally, over more than six decades the watch has gone through some changes. The main change has affected the dial – it has gained a date display window at nine o’clock, the Breitling logo in the center and larger sub-dials. These sub-dials at 9, 12 and 6 o’clock indicate hours, minutes and seconds, respectively.
Breitling Navimeter ChronographDue to the modern lifestyle which includes a lot of flying, Breitling has integrated a bright red hand providing the time in a second time zone. The case of the Breitling Navitimer Quartz Chronograph has become a little larger. Finally, not long after the quartz revolution, the manual-winding Venus movement of the wristwatch was replaced by a quartz one.

The winding crown on the right side of the Breitling Navitimer Quartz Chronograph is not screw-locked, that is why the watch is water-resistant only to 30 meters. It means that the timepiece should not be worn while swimming or diving, but can withstand splashes of rain or water.
The timepiece comes in a number of versions. It can be made from gold with steel or stainless steel only and have bracelets crafted either from leather or from gold.

Rolex Submariner Every brand has a secret of success. The secret of the watchmaking company with, perhaps, the most recognizable name in the industry, Rolex, is in continuity in design. The watches created a few decades ago are updated and improved, but still have basically the same appearance. Thanks in no small part to this longstanding tradition, the Rolex Oyster Submariner has become one of the most popular watches of the brand.
The first Rolex Oyster Submariner watch was introduced in 1953, and was revealed at the Basel Show in 1954. Throughout more than fifty years, a few things have changed. The movement has become more advanced – it is now magnetic- and shock-resistant, as well as equipped with the latest innovation of Rolex - the Parachrom hairspring, improving the precision of the watch. As of 2007, it was also certified by the Official Swiss Chronometer Testing Institute. Another change affected the dial of the Rolex Oyster Submariner - a mixture of tritium and phospor is now used to paint luminescent indices instead of less safe radium paint. Finally, in the late 1960s a date display window appeared at 3 o’clock.
Rolex SubmarinerBut in general, the Rolex Oyster Submariner remained the same. The watch is water-resistant to 300 meters, which makes it perfect for diving. The winding crown of the watch has the Triplock system, ensuring that water does not enter the inside of the case and damage the movement. The case of the timepiece is made from gold or corrosion-resistant 904L stainless steel and features a unidirectional, counterclockwise rotatable bezel for safe immersion. The dial of the watch is still easily recognizable by the so-called Mercedes hands and the Submariner logo. The bracelet of the Rolex Oyster Submariner is made from stainless steel and comes with an extension link which allows the owner of the watch to wear it in a wetsuit.

There is a close association between sports cars and luxury watches: they are both driven by passion, accuracy and performance. Throughout the history of watchmaking, many timepieces have been inspired by racing cars. This is the case with the Chopard Mille Miglia Gran Turismo XL GMT which has been inspired by an Italian endurance race, the Mille Miglia.

This new member of the Chopard Mille Miglia collection comes in two versions – either in 18K rose gold or stainless steel. The 44mm case is protected by a convex sapphire crystal with anti-reflective treatment. The screw-in crown on the right side of the watch contributes to its 100m water resistance.
The Chopard Mille Miglia Gran Turismo XL GMT features a black dial with Superluminova-coated indices, numerals and hands. What strikes in the dial of the timepiece the most is the picture of the globe printed in white on black. The red arrow-shaped hand in the center of the dial, the distinctive mark of the Mille Miglia collection, indicates the second time zone. A date window is displayed at 3 o’clock. Two oversized Arabic numerals – 6 and 12 – make the Chopard Mille Miglia Gran Turismo XL GMT watch look sportier.
The timepiece is powered by a COSC-certified mechanical self-winding movement which guarantees its accuracy and reliability and means that the watch has passed seven tests of accuracy under various conditions. The movement provides a 46-hour power reserve and beats 28,800 times per hour.
The strap of the Chopard Mille Miglia Gran Turismo XL GMT comes in three versions. If the watch is made from steel, it might come with a matching steel bracelet. Straps made from rubber with the 1960s Dunlop Racing tire-tread motif and from Barenia leather are also available.
